    Who is Dr. Wilken, Pediatrician in Monticello, NY?

    Dr. Philip Wilken, MD is a Pediatrician, who primarily practices in Monticello, NY with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ine and American Board of Pediatrics. Dr. Wilken graduated from Albany Medical College of Union University and completed his residency at Med Coll Of Virginia Hosp, Internal Medicine/Pediatrics. Dr. Wilken is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Wilken’s practice accepts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Philip Wilken's specialty?

    Dr. Wilken is a Pediatrician near Monticello, NY. A pediatrician focuses on the physical, emotional, and social health of children from birth through young adulthood. Their care includes a wide range of health services, from preventive healthcare to diagnosing and treating acute and chronic diseases. Pediatricians consider the biological, social, and environmental influences on a child's development, as well as how diseases and dysfunctions can impact growth and overall development.
